1. 什么是HTTP代理?理解HTTP代理的基本概念和工作原理 2. 如何使用HTTP代理?探索HTTP代理的作用和应用场景

   搜狗SEO    

了解HTTP代理之前,我们需要先了解一下什么是代理服务器。

什么是代理服务器

代理服务器是一种中间服务器,它充当在客户端和目标服务器之间的“中间人”。它可以为客户端提供一些额外的服务,例如缓存、过滤、隐私保护等。客户端的请求首先发送到代理服务器,然后由代理服务器转发到目标服务器,同样,目标服务器的响应也是先返回给代理服务器,再由代理服务器转发给客户端。

什么是HTTP代理

HTTP代理是一种网络服务,它允许客户端通过代理服务器与目标服务器进行通信。HTTP代理是基于HTTP协议的代理服务器,客户端发送的请求以及目标服务器返回的响应都是遵循HTTP协议的。

HTTP代理

HTTP代理的作用

内容缓存

代理服务器可以缓存经常访问的内容,减少对原始服务器的请求,提高访问速度。当客户端再次请求相同的内容时,代理服务器直接从缓存中获取,不需要再向原始服务器发起请求。

内容过滤

代理服务器可以过滤掉恶意或不适当的内容,保护用户免受不良信息的影响。例如可以过滤掉包含恶意代码的网页或色情内容的网页等。

隐私保护

代理服务器可以隐藏用户的IP地址,保护用户的隐私。当客户端向代理服务器发起请求时,目标服务器只能看到代理服务器的IP地址,无法获取客户端的真实IP地址。

负载均衡

在有多个服务器的情况下,代理服务器可以将请求分发到不同的服务器上,实现负载均衡。这样可以避免某个服务器负载过重导致服务质量下降。

访问控制

代理服务器可以根据需要限制对某些网站的访问。例如可以禁止员工在工作时间访问社交网站,从而提高员工的工作效率。

HTTP代理的应用场景

HTTP代理具有广泛的应用场景,以下是其中的一些举例。

场景 描述
网络加速 当用户访问的网站在海外或者网络延迟较高时,使用HTTP代理可以显著提高访问速度。
访问限制网站 有些网站可能因为各种原因在某些地区无法访问,使用HTTP代理可以绕过这些限制。
数据抓取 在进行网页抓取时,为了防止被目标网站封禁,可以使用HTTP代理来改变IP地址。
网络安全 在公共WiFi等不安全的网络环境下,使用HTTP代理可以增加一层保护,防止个人信息泄露。
企业应用 在企业内部,可以通过设置HTTP代理来实现对员工上网行为的管理和控制。

以上就是关于HTTP代理的基本介绍,HTTP代理作为一种重要的网络服务,在网络应用中被广泛使用。如果你想深入了解HTTP代理,可以参考相关的技术文档或教程。

如果你对代理服务器或其他网络技术有什么疑问或建议,欢迎在评论区留言,我将会耐心回复。

同时,如果你觉得本文对你有所帮助,请点赞、评论、分享,让更多人看到这篇文章。感谢你的观看!

评论留言

我要留言

欢迎参与讨论,请在这里发表您的看法、交流您的观点。